Our Uniform

 

Year 7-11 

 

Unform Rules 

If a student arrives wearing incorrect uniform, action will be taken to rectify. The school will lend replacements but if a student refuses to wear the item(s), there will be a more serious sanction.

Items  

A North Chadderton school embossed blazer

A white shirt with tie or a blue blouse

An optional navy jumper or cardigan (woolen)

Trousers – Black, grey or navy (not leggings and not tapered)

Skirts – Navy pleated or straight and must be unrolled.

Tights – Black or navy (40 denier plus)

Socks – Black or navy (no logo)

Footwear - Boots or Trainers must not be worn Trainers are only permitted for PE or performing arts lessons

Coats - Coats are not to be worn in the school building at any time

Jewellery – pupils may wear a watch and no other jewellery

Piercings - Ear/nose piercing should be done at the beginning of summer holidays. Plaster over new studs are not acceptable.

Nails - Nail varnish/gel nails/acrylic nails are not to be worn

Hair - Extremes of colour (unnatural) and styles are not acceptable. Number 0 and 1 length are not acceptable. Minimum length is a Number 2.

Hair accessories – a simple elastic bobble.

Belts – No large belt buckles Hats/caps/sunglasses must not be worn

False tan/fake eyelashes/excessive makeup must not be worn.

 

 

PE Kit 

NC Polo top 

NC Shorts or NC leggings 

Navy football socks 

Sport trainers (Not Kicker pumps) 

Optional NC rain jacket or NC sweater jumper 

 

 

Year 12-13 

Business Dress: Monday to Thursday 

 

  • Suit consisting of a suit jacket and skirt, dress or tailored trousers.  
  • Suit jackets must be worn at all times.  
  • Skirts should be of a suitable length and must be appropriate for a business environment.  
  • A shirt, blouse or top of any colour may be worn and must be appropriate for a business environment. Suit shirts must be worn with ties.  
  • Smart footwear. Trainers are not allowed.  

  

Photo ID must be worn visibly at all times while on college premises.  

 

Dress Down: Friday  

 

Own clothes may be worn on Fridays to reflect practice in many large businesses in our country and indeed, world-wide.  

The aim is to have a smart appearance that allows a degree of personal choice. However, your college is a workplace and a learning environment, and your appearance should reflect that.  

Shorts and short skirts are not permitted. Tops that expose the abdomen are unacceptable as are strapless, backless, see-through, or strappy vest tops.  

Photo ID must be worn visibly at all times while on college premises.  

  

In the event of extreme weather conditions, this dress code may be subject to change at the discretion of the Assistant Director and/or Headteacher.
